What Is Mini Split System Heat?

Mini split systems are a type of heat pump that provide both heating and cooling. They are small, efficient units which are installed in the walls or ceilings of a building, and use a refrigerant to heat and cool the air. The system only runs when it needs to, meaning it uses less energy and produces fewer emissions than other heating systems.

How Can Mini Split System Heat Help with Facilities Management?

Mini split system heat offers many benefits when it comes to facilities management. The main advantage is its energy efficiency. The systems are designed to be as efficient as possible, helping to reduce energy costs. They also require minimal maintenance, meaning fewer repairs and less downtime. In addition, they are flexible, allowing for individual temperature control in different parts of the building, meaning you can effectively manage the overall temperature.
